The Past Self

The selfishness and ignorance of inexperience

At living in a universe of individuals

Does mutilate my memories of juvinility.

Maturity of consciousness breeds humiliation

Of reactions and responses, and in retrospection,

One ambition keeps repressing the demoralizing:

To vow to keep moving forward.
